Electronics & Data Analysis InternshipDescription -Are you an analytical person who enjoys Big Data analysis? Do you have an electronics background and want to grow in this area? HP Inc and be part of one of the most recognized supply chains in the industry!We are the Procurement team for electromechanical parts within the Large Format Printing Business and 3D Business (aka LFP & 3D). We take care of direct materials procurement, and our deliverables are directly linked with the parts specifications, availability and suitability for all our needs.PPSC is the acronym for the whole HP Procurement team and concerns the supply chain inbound.Main ResponsibilitiesSupport PPSC Large Format Printing and 3D EMECH team in the development of analysis tools to support Printed Circuit Assembly industrialization, design, and production.Focus in the spend analytics, tracking and impact analysis for the various Manufacturer Partners.Help the PPSC senior engineers with the different guidelines to be developed, maintained and communication WITH R&D and Operations Communities.Be part of the PPSC electronics team, working closely to RD and operations to optimize Electronics design in terms of EE components selection, and cost analysisDevelop the data analysis layer for tracking Quality Data to improve industrialization activities, test coverage and faster TAT for corrective actions.What are we looking for'Fourth-year student, as well as master’s, currently enrolled in electronics or industrial engineering. Other related disciplines may be acceptable, depending on the technical knowledge. Academic agreement is required. Interest in Data Mining and Big Data would be a plus.Tools needed: MS Office (PowerPoint, Excel, etc.), Power BI. Knowledge in coding would be a plus.Strong data analytics and reporting skills: ability to analyze data and interpret it accurately to get conclusions.Proactive, curious, and dynamic personality: Capacity and eagerness to learn quickly new tools, processes, methods, etc.Autonomous and self-sufficient person: availability to work on your…
